§ 43.653 — HUNTING LICENSE REQUIRED

PW § 43.653Title 5. WILDLIFE AND PLANT CONSERVATION · Part A. HUNTING AND FISHING LICENSES · Ch. 43. SPECIAL LICENSES AND PERMITS · Art. S. MIGRATORY AND UPLAND GAME BIRD STAMPS

Statute text

View on source
The possession of either a migratory or upland game bird stamp does not authorize a person to hunt a migratory or upland game bird:
(1)without possessing a hunting license as provided by Chapter 42; or
(2)at any time or by means not otherwise authorized by this code.

Legislative history

Added by Acts 2005, 79th Leg., Ch. 882 (S.B. 1192), Sec. 1, eff. June 17, 2005.
